    I've seen that before and I think it's super cute.  It's also something that you could make for much less than what you'll pay on Etsy, but not sure if it's something that you would be willing to do.  But, if you want to tackle the project yourself, all you need is the frame (Goodwill find?) a piece of wood cut to size and some chalk board paint.  I want a chalk board sign for our ceremony as well, and it's going to be a project that FI and I will do together, since he likes building things and using tools and all that boy stuff.

    I made my own sign.

    It says, "Here for the bride? Here for the groom? It doesn't matter, we're all family soon. Please take a seat wherever you'd like."

    I swear I take pictures of all my DIY stuff, but can't find a pic of that. It's being stored at my parents.

    Anyways, I just bought a piece of wood from JoAnn's, stained it brown and then painted the words on there in a whitish/ivory color and put some little decorative butterfly things on it.
